Gloria J. Parks Community Center
The Gloria J. Parks Community Center, located at 3242 Main Street in Buffalo, New York, is a hub of activity and support for the University District community. Operated by the University District Community Development Association (UDCDA), the center offers a wide range of programs for both youth and seniors. From educational opportunities to recreational activities, the center provides a welcoming space for residents to come together and engage with one another. In addition to its programs, the UDCDA also works on community and housing development projects throughout Buffalo's Northeast. By collaborating with residents, block clubs, nonprofits, educational institutions, and local government, the UDCDA is dedicated to investing resources in the people and places that are vital to the community. With its main offices located at 995 Kensington Avenue, the UDCDA is committed to making a positive impact on the University District and beyond.

Harlem Children’s Zone - Geoffrey Canada Community Center (GCCC)
The Harlem Children’s Zone - Geoffrey Canada Community Center (GCCC) is a vital institution located at 35 East 125th Street in New York, United States. Named in honor of HCZ’s founder and president, the Geoffrey Canada Community Center has been a hub of learning, support, and celebration since 2004. This welcoming space serves as a centerpiece of HCZ and Central Harlem, offering a wide range of services and activities to the community. The GCCC is home to the Harlem Children’s Zone Promise Academy II Middle School and High School, providing a space for education and personal growth. In addition, the center hosts group activities, social support programs, and public information sessions for members of the Central Harlem community. All activities at GCCC are free and open to the public.
